The unissued Motown song that became a northern soul classic

Summary by Far Out Magazine
A music mogul with an intimate knowledge of the singles charts, Berry Gordy always aimed to embody Motown Records’ ‘Hitsville’ moniker, even if that meant leaving countless potential hits gathering dust in the corner, never to see the light of day.
